As a basic framework for defining the sector, the United Nations' International Requirement Industrial Classification classifies health care as generally consisting of health center activities, medical and oral practice activities, and "other human health activities." The last class involves activities of, or under the supervision of, nurses, midwives, physio therapists, clinical or diagnostic labs, pathology clinics, domestic health centers, patient supporters or other allied health professions.

For example, pharmaceuticals and other medical gadgets are the leading high technology exports of Europe and the United States. The United States controls the biopharmaceutical field, accounting for three-quarters of the world's biotechnology earnings. There are normally five primary techniques of financing healthcare systems: general tax to the state, county or town voluntary or private health insurance coverage donations to health charities In most countries, there is a mix of all 5 designs, however this varies across countries and over time within nations. Aside from funding systems, a crucial concern needs to always be just how much to invest on health care.

In OECD nations for every additional $1000 invested in health care, life span falls by 0.4 years. [] A similar correlation is seen from analysis performed each year by Bloomberg. Clearly this kind of analysis is flawed because life span is only one procedure of a health system's performance, however equally, the idea that more financing is much better is not supported.

The United States (17.7%, or US$ PPP 8,508), the Netherlands (11.9%, 5,099), France (11.6%, 4,118), Germany (11.3%, 4,495), Canada (11.2%, 5669), and Switzerland (11%, 5,634) were the top spenders, nevertheless life expectancy in overall population at birth was highest in Switzerland (82.8 years), Japan and Italy (82.7 ), Spain and Iceland (82.4 ), France (82.2) and Australia (82.0 ), while OECD's typical exceeds 80 years for the very first time ever in 2011: 80.1 years, a gain of 10 years because 1970. for services such as banking or health care.

All OECD nations have actually achieved universal (or almost universal) health coverage, other than the United States and Mexico (how long is the episode of care for home health services?). In the United States, where around 18% of GDP is spent on healthcare, the Commonwealth Fund analysis of invest and quality reveals a clear correlation in between worse quality and higher costs.

In particular, the practice of health professionals and operation of health care organizations is generally regulated by nationwide or state/provincial authorities through appropriate regulatory bodies for functions of quality assurance. The majority of countries have credentialing personnel in regulative boards or health departments who document the accreditation or licensing of health employees and their work history.

Electronic Medical Record (EMR) - An EMR contains the standard medical and clinical information gathered in one's supplier's workplace. Personal Health Record (PHR) - A PHR is a patient's medical history that is preserved independently, for personal use. Medical Practice Management software (MPM) - is designed to streamline the daily tasks of operating a medical center.

Health Details Exchange (HIE) - Health Details Exchange permits health care professionals and patients to appropriately access and firmly share a patient's vital medical information electronically.
